Output d21ebc0c96ea5283f1b60f46fd71b80dcffd9cb2a55dc3807ee89cb61157838d:5

value
21091907
script pubkey
OP_0 OP_PUSHBYTES_20 51b6fd5bea238b1a7b100ac9054e80f8d11656de
address
ltc1q2xm06kl2yw9357csptys2n5qlrg3v4k74mkwwy
transaction
d21ebc0c96ea5283f1b60f46fd71b80dcffd9cb2a55dc3807ee89cb61157838d
spent
true